March 19, 1947, 12-mile Swamp. By Dave Marshall and Tom McAllister. Canada Geese ssp? - about 1000 seen Mallard - an estimated 200 Gadwall - 3 females and 4 males Pintail - an estimated 350 Green-winged Teal - 25 individuals Shoveller - about 40 males, but only 5 females Turkey Vulture - Marsh Hawk Sparrow Hawk Wilson's Snipe - we split and walked across about two acres of wet field, flushing a total of 61 of these birds. Greater Yellow legs - 9 of them W. Belted Kingfisher Tree Swallows - many Violet-green Swallows - many Tule Wren Robin Redwings Oregon Towhee Song Sparrows March 20, 1947, Pacific/ Yellow-throat heard
